what’s Adenoiditis?
Adenoiditis refers to an inflammatory or enlarged state of the adenoids. Here are small pads of lymph tissue located high in the throat, behind the nose, in the nasopharynx. When these tissues swell, they can obstruct nasal airflow, leading to a cascade of breathing, sleep, ear, and sinus problems. The adenoids are a vital component of the immune system, especially active during childhood as they help trap germs and pathogens entering the body through the nose and mouth. Typically, they begin to shrink during adolescence, a process that often resolves symptoms. However, when adenoids remain enlarged or are subject to repeated infections, they can interfere with normal breathing and the proper drainage of the nasal and sinus cavities.
This condition is more than just a persistent stuffy nose. Chronic mouth breathing, a common consequence of enlarged adenoids, can lead to a dry mouth, disrupted sleep, and potentially affect speech development, facial structure, and academic performance in children. While less common in adults, persistent adenoid-related symptoms warrant a thorough medical evaluation.

What are the Symptoms of Adenoiditis?
The hallmark symptom of adenoiditis is nasal obstruction — which frequently results in mouth breathing, loud snoring, and difficulty achieving restful sleep. When swollen adenoids block the nearby openings of the Eustachian tubes, they can also contribute to ear pressure, recurrent ear infections (otitis media), and chronic sinus congestion. Differentiating adenoiditis from common colds or allergies often hinges on the persistence and cyclical nature of the symptoms. While a cold is transient, adenoid-related blockage tends to recur or remain constant.
Common symptoms to monitor include:
- Nasal blockage or a perpetually stuffy nose
- Mouth breathing, especially noticeable during sleep
- Loud snoring or restless sleep patterns
- Observed pauses in breathing during sleep (potential signs of sleep apnea)
- Frequent ear infections or the presence of fluid behind the eardrum (otitis media with effusion)
- Chronic sinus congestion or recurrent sinusitis
- Muffled or a distinctly nasal quality to speech
- Dry mouth and persistent bad breath upon waking
A key indicator, especially in children, is a pattern of recurrent otitis media with effusion coupled with consistent mouth breathing throughout the day. This combination often points more strongly towards adenoid issues than isolated instances of sore throats or common colds.

What Causes Adenoiditis?
Adenoiditis is typically triggered by infection, inflammation, or prolonged irritation of the adenoid tissue. Viral upper respiratory infections, such as the common cold, are frequent culprits. Bacterial infections, including streptococcal infections, can also develop and contribute to adenoid swelling. Other contributing factors include allergic rhinitis (nasal allergies), chronic exposure to irritants like tobacco smoke or air pollution, and recurrent throat infections. In some instances, gastroesophageal reflux disease (GERD) may also play a role in adenoid inflammation.
Children are especially susceptible because their immune systems are still developing, making their adenoids more reactive. Here’s why adenoiditis is most prevalent in preschool and school-aged children. As mentioned, the adenoid tissue naturally shrinks with age, often leading to symptom improvement during adolescence. This natural involution is one reason why symptoms may diminish over time.
Main Causes and Triggers:
- Viral infections (e.g., common cold, influenza)
- Bacterial infections (e.g., streptococcal pharyngitis)
- Allergic rhinitis and persistent nasal inflammation
- Chronic sinusitis
- Exposure to environmental irritants (tobacco smoke, air pollution)
- Gastroesophageal reflux disease (GERD)
A Key aspect to understand is that enlarged adenoids can act as both a cause and a consequence of repeated infections. Swelling can impede proper drainage from the nasal passages and sinuses, leading to mucus buildup. This stagnant mucus creates an ideal environment for bacterial growth, perpetuating the cycle of infection and inflammation. This cyclical process is often why adenoiditis symptoms can feel so persistent and difficult to resolve.
How is Adenoiditis Diagnosed?
The diagnostic process for adenoiditis begins with a thorough review of the patient’s symptoms, sleep patterns, and medical history, especially regarding recurrent infections. A physical examination focuses on the nose, throat, and ears, observing breathing patterns and any visible signs of congestion or inflammation. If adenoid enlargement is suspected, an Ear, Nose, and Throat (ENT) specialist may employ nasal endoscopy. This procedure involves inserting a thin, flexible tube with a light and camera (an endoscope) into the nose, allowing for a direct visualization of the adenoid tissue in the nasopharynx.
In certain situations, imaging techniques such as X-rays or CT scans may be considered, especially if the diagnosis is unclear or to assess associated sinus or ear issues. However, nasal endoscopy is often the most definitive method for assessing the size and impact of the adenoids. Doctors will also diligently look for related conditions, such as fluid in the middle ear, signs of sleep-disordered breathing, or active sinus infections, to understand the full scope of the problem.
The primary goal of diagnosis isn’t merely to identify adenoiditis but to ascertain the degree to which it affects breathing, sleep quality, and overall daily function. This complete approach ensures that the treatment plan is tailored to the individual’s specific needs.
Common Diagnostic Steps:
- Detailed symptom and medical history review
- Physical examination of the head and neck
- Nasal endoscopy for direct visualization of adenoids
- Hearing tests (audiometry) if recurrent ear infections are present
- Imaging studies (X-ray, CT scan) when indicated for complex cases or to evaluate related structures
You should note that relying solely on repeated antibiotic treatments without confirming the underlying cause can be counterproductive. If enlarged adenoids are the primary issue, treating every nasal symptom as a bacterial infection may delay appropriate management and miss the persistent pattern of obstruction.
What are the Best Treatment Options in 2026?
The optimal treatment strategy for adenoiditis in 2026 is highly individualized, depending on the severity of the condition, the frequency of symptoms, and the extent to which it impacts breathing and daily life. For mild cases, a conservative approach is often recommended — which may include watchful waiting, regular saline nasal rinses to clear congestion, effective management of allergies through antihistamines or nasal corticosteroids, and targeted medications to address specific symptoms like congestion or infection.
However, for persistent, severe, or obstructive cases, surgical removal of the adenoids, known as an adenoidectomy, becomes a primary consideration. This procedure is especially effective when adenoid enlargement is causing significant breathing difficulties, chronic sinus infections, or recurrent middle ear problems.
Current Treatment Approaches:
- Watchful Waiting: For mild, intermittent symptoms, observation may be sufficient as adenoids naturally shrink.
- Saline Nasal Rinses: Helps to clear mucus and reduce inflammation in the nasal passages.
- Medications: Antihistamines and nasal corticosteroids for allergies. decongestants and antibiotics if a bacterial infection is confirmed.
- Antibiotics: Prescribed for confirmed bacterial infections of the adenoids or associated sinusitis.
- Adenoidectomy: Surgical removal of the adenoids, recommended for severe obstruction, chronic infections, or significant sleep-disordered breathing.

When Should You See a Doctor?
it’s advisable to consult a healthcare professional, preferably an ENT specialist, if you or your child experiences persistent symptoms suggestive of adenoiditis. Key indicators that warrant medical attention include:
- Chronic nasal congestion that doesn’t resolve with over-the-counter remedies.
- Frequent mouth breathing, especially during sleep.
- Loud snoring or observed pauses in breathing during sleep.
- Recurrent ear infections (more than 3-4 in a year) or persistent fluid behind the eardrum.
- Chronic sinus congestion or recurrent sinus infections.
- Speech that sounds consistently nasal or muffled.
- Persistent bad breath or dry mouth upon waking.
- Daytime sleepiness, irritability, or difficulty concentrating in children.
Early evaluation can help identify the cause of these symptoms and prevent potential complications such as hearing loss from chronic ear infections, dental problems from prolonged mouth breathing, or developmental issues in children.

What are adenoids and why do they matter?
Adenoids are small lymph tissue pads located in the nasopharynx (the upper part of the throat behind the nose). they’re part of the immune system and help trap germs. they’re most prominent in childhood and typically shrink during adolescence. When they become inflamed or enlarged due to infection, allergies, or other irritants, they can block nasal airflow and lead to various health issues.
Can allergies cause adenoiditis?
Yes, allergic rhinitis is a common cause of adenoid enlargement and inflammation. The chronic inflammation associated with allergies can lead to persistent swelling of the adenoid tissue, mimicking or exacerbating symptoms of infection-related adenoiditis.
Is adenoiditis the same as sleep apnea?
Enlarged adenoids are a common cause of obstructive sleep apnea (OSA) in children. While adenoiditis refers to the inflammation or enlargement of the adenoids, sleep apnea is a sleep disorder characterized by repeated pauses in breathing during sleep. When enlarged adenoids obstruct the airway, they can trigger or contribute to OSA. Treatment of the adenoid issue can often resolve or improve pediatric sleep apnea.
What are the risks of adenoidectomy?
Adenoidectomy is generally considered a safe procedure. However, like any surgery, it carries potential risks, though they’re uncommon. These can include bleeding, infection, reactions to anesthesia, injury to nearby structures, or incomplete removal of the adenoids. In rare cases, changes in voice quality or nasal regurgitation may occur temporarily. Your surgeon will discuss these risks in detail before the procedure.
How long does recovery take after an adenoidectomy?
Recovery time varies but most children and adults can return to normal activities within one to two weeks after an adenoidectomy. During this period, it’s common to experience a sore throat, ear pain, and some nasal congestion or drainage. Following post-operative care instructions, including dietary recommendations and activity restrictions, is Key for a smooth recovery.
